If you're using C# to code this "console grabber", this is a known problem.
One would think that implementing GenerateConsoleCtrlEvent should do the trick, but alas. The second argument is supposed to be the process group ID, but most C# code will start processes using System.Diagnostics.Process, which do not have a way of setting this needed process group ID. The "most common" advice on the net, is to create a small app that takes a process id as an argument, attaches that process, and the utilizes GenerateConsoleCtrlEvent using 0 (zero) as the process group id (sending Ctrl-C to both the attached process and it self). LLR indeed seems to checkpoint every 30 minutes, that's not too bad, it'll lose an average of 15 minutes if a client is killed. I still think the 2.4.x prp client and/or llr behave differently, because with that version I still seem to fall back way further even if I leave it for more than half an hour. I do see the zxxxxx file being updated every half hour, though... Thanks for the replies here they gave me a much better insight in prp,llr and their friends :-) |
